The good news is that some of the best advice has been provided for you in this article.Get a polishing cloth for your jewelery. This is a very easy way to make them shine and not have to use any type of chemicals or solvents. Use the two-sided cloth to polish your jewelry as if you were cleaning glass. First you should use the polish side, then use the shining side to really make your jewelry look stunning!Don’t clean your jewelry in harsh household chemicals like ammonia, bleach or turpentine. Doing so can damage the shine and luster of the stones on your favorite pieces.Before you buy a gemstone, ask what type of gemstone it is. Gemstones now come in natural as well as synthetic and imitation types. You have to know that imitation refers to colored plastic. Natural gems are dug up from the ground, and synthetic gems are man-made in a lab.Keep your jewelry pieces looking beautiful by protecting them from tarnish. For example, avoid taking your jewelry somewhere it can get wet. If you let some metals get wet too often, they can tarnish, rust or become dull. Pin it to the middle of the waist or close to your hip.Costume jewelry needs special care. Many pieces of costume jewelry have the stones glued on, for example. Don’t immerse costume jewelry in water, and never wash costume jewelery pieces with harsh chemicals. The best way to clean these pieces are to wipe them clean with a damp cloth and dry immediately with another cloth. You want to avoid unknowingly cleaning the gem with a chemical or solution that could strip off the protective treatment.Don’t wear jewelry when swimming. Your jewelry’s luster and life can be damaged from the chlorine that is present in the pool water. Salt water is equally as bad for your jewelry.
